National Science Foundation

 

Academic Institutional Profiles: 2007 [27 August 2010]

http://www.nsf.gov/statistics/profiles/

 

Academic Institutional Profiles are produced annually by the Division of Science Resources Statistics (SRS) of the National Science Foundation (NSF). Profiles are produced for universities and colleges that have reported nonzero data within the past 3 survey years in at least two of the following annual surveys:

 

•Survey of Research and Development Expenditures at Universities and Colleges

•Survey of Federal Science and Engineering Support to Universities, Colleges and Nonprofit Institutions

•Survey of Graduate Students and Postdoctorates in Science and Engineering and Health Fields

•Survey of Earned Doctorates

 

The profiles are updated after data from all four surveys are finalized and released. Trend data for selected years are displayed in statistical tables within each profile.

 

Each profile also includes the institution's ranking on an aggregate measure for each survey if the institution has a nonzero value for that measure for the latest year reported for the survey. Tied institutions are ranked alphabetically in the accompanying ranking tables.
